Scholarship Description: Investment Climate and Business Environment (ICBE) Research Fund, founded in 2006, is a joint research facility of TrustAfrica and the International Development Research Centre (IDRC). The Doctoral Grants aim is to promote practical research on ways to improve the investment climate and business environment throughout Africa and strengthening private sector performance, which in turn will help create jobs, alleviate poverty and contribute towards economic growth and independence of the continent. http://www.callforpapersinfo.com
http://thescholarshipprogramme.com
Doctoral Grants Research Fund thus built on the twin pillars of improving the environment for entrepreneurship to accelerate growth and empowerment of the poor to participate and benefit from this growth. It also aims to strengthen the capacity of research teams working on issues ICBE and to promote the dissemination of research results among policy makers, private sector and other relevant stakeholders.

The Public Health Scholarships program aims to make Norway an attractive destination for Ph.D. research highly qualified international students and young researchers in all subject areas, thereby strengthening the Norwegian research community involved.

Public Health Scholarships Grant applications will be accepted from the following countries:
European Countries: All countries, including all Council of Europe member states, except for the Nordic countries (Denmark, Finland, Iceland, Norway and Sweden).
Non-European countries: Argentina, Brazil, Chile, Egypt, India, Israel, Japan, Mexico and South Africa.


This Public Health Scholarships programme/activity normally accepts grant applications from:

- Ph.D. students admitted to an organised doctoral degree programme;
- Younger researchers who completed a Ph.D. degree not more than six years prior to submission of the grant application.
Applicants must be affiliated with a higher education and/or research institution in one of the countries covered under the programme.

Overall budget:

The annual budget framework is about NOK 10 million.
